Groovy Documentation

org.hidetake.gradle.ssh.internal
[Groovy] Class DryRunOperationHandler

java.lang.Object
  org.hidetake.gradle.ssh.internal.AbstractOperationHandler
      org.hidetake.gradle.ssh.internal.DryRunOperationHandler

@TupleConstructor
@Slf4j
class DryRunOperationHandler
extends AbstractOperationHandler

Null implementation of OperationHandler for dry-run.

Authors:
hidetake.org


Property Summary
SessionSpec spec

 
Method Summary
java.lang.String execute(java.util.Map options, java.lang.String command, groovy.lang.Closure interactions)

CommandContext executeBackground(java.util.Map options, java.lang.String command)

java.lang.String executeSudo(java.util.Map options, java.lang.String command)

void get(java.util.Map options, java.lang.String remote, java.lang.String local)

Remote getRemote()

void put(java.util.Map options, java.lang.String local, java.lang.String remote)

void shell(java.util.Map options, groovy.lang.Closure interactions)

 
Methods inherited from class AbstractOperationHandler
execute, execute, execute, executeBackground, executeSudo, get, put, shell
 

Property Detail

spec

final SessionSpec spec


 
Method Detail

execute

@Override
java.lang.String execute(java.util.Map options, java.lang.String command, groovy.lang.Closure interactions)


executeBackground

@Override
CommandContext executeBackground(java.util.Map options, java.lang.String command)


executeSudo

@Override
java.lang.String executeSudo(java.util.Map options, java.lang.String command)


get

@Override
void get(java.util.Map options, java.lang.String remote, java.lang.String local)


getRemote

@Override
Remote getRemote()


put

@Override
void put(java.util.Map options, java.lang.String local, java.lang.String remote)


shell

@Override
void shell(java.util.Map options, groovy.lang.Closure interactions)


 

Groovy Documentation